Output 66823f9454dcd05abce91dad29238b07064098dab4e1963bdbab8d5e0fb4f2fe:1

value
115680
script pubkey
OP_0 OP_PUSHBYTES_20 86dae35db4af38446942ed289b1124ce42e5abd2
address
bc1qsmdwxhd54uuyg62za55fkyfyeepwt27juzmu5c
transaction
66823f9454dcd05abce91dad29238b07064098dab4e1963bdbab8d5e0fb4f2fe
confirmations
197410
spent
true